Types of Tire Changers

The tire changing industry has evolved significantly over the years, leading to the development of various types of tire changers. Each type is designed to cater to specific needs and preferences, making it essential to understand the differences between them. Manual tire changers are the most basic type, requiring physical effort to loosen and remove the tire. They are ideal for small garages or personal use, as they are affordable and easy to maintain. Automatic tire changers, on the other hand, use advanced technology to simplify the process, reducing the risk of injury and increasing efficiency.

The semi-automatic tire changer is another popular option, offering a balance between manual and automatic models. It uses a combination of manual and automated processes to change tires, making it a versatile choice for various applications. The fully automatic tire changer is the most advanced type, featuring advanced robotics and sensors to change tires quickly and accurately. This type is commonly used in high-volume tire shops and dealerships, where speed and efficiency are crucial.

In addition to these types, there are also specialized tire changers designed for specific vehicles or tire sizes. For example, motorcycle tire changers are designed for the unique requirements of motorcycle tires, while truck tire changers are built to handle the larger tires used in commercial vehicles. Tire Changer Maintenance and Troubleshooting

Regular maintenance and troubleshooting are essential to ensure the optimal performance and longevity of a tire changer. The maintenance requirements vary depending on the type and model of the changer, but there are some general procedures that can be followed. One of the most critical maintenance tasks is to regularly lubricate the moving parts, such as the clamping system and drive shaft, to prevent wear and tear.

Cleaning the tire changer is also essential, as dirt and debris can accumulate and cause malfunctions. The changer’s electrical and pneumatic systems should also be inspected regularly to ensure that they are functioning correctly. Additionally, the tire changer’s clamping system should be adjusted and calibrated periodically to maintain its accuracy and stability. By following these maintenance procedures, you can minimize downtime and extend the lifespan of the changer.

Troubleshooting is also an essential skill when working with tire changers, as malfunctions can occur unexpectedly. One of the most common issues is the changer’s inability to loosen or tighten the tire, which can be caused by a variety of factors, including worn or damaged clamping pads, incorrect clamping pressure, or a malfunctioning drive system. In such cases, it is essential to consult the user manual or contact the manufacturer’s technical support for assistance.

The use of diagnostic tools, such as pressure gauges and multimeters, can also help to identify and troubleshoot issues with the tire changer. Tire Changer Safety Precautions

Tire changers can be hazardous if not used properly, and it is essential to follow safety precautions to prevent accidents and injuries. One of the most critical safety considerations is to ensure that the tire changer is properly installed and calibrated, as incorrect installation can lead to malfunctions and accidents. The user should also read and follow the manufacturer’s instructions and guidelines, as well as wear personal protective equipment, such as gloves and safety glasses, when operating the changer.

The work area around the tire changer should also be clear of obstacles and tripping hazards, and the floor should be level and non-slip. The tire changer’s emergency stop button should be easily accessible, and the user should know how to operate it in case of an emergency. Additionally, the changer’s clamping system should be designed to prevent the tire from falling or becoming dislodged during the changing process, which can cause serious injury.

Regular maintenance and inspection of the tire changer are also essential safety precautions, as worn or damaged components can increase the risk of accidents. The user should also be aware of the tire changer’s limitations and capacities, and never attempt to change a tire that exceeds the changer’s rated capacity.
